94346, HELP!! Car bucking like a Mule!! Poss Ign., fuel prob? kinda long Posted by foggy45, Nov-07-05 01:40 PM
heres the deal, when i get on the gas med to hard about 3k rpm it bucks liek it misfires or somthing. i can hear the report come out of the intake. it dosent happen at the same rpm or the same gear either, but i can never do a full on redline run. if i ease into the gas i can make it almost to redline before it bucks. (by bucking i mean a sudden loss of power then its back on again. like hi-rpm fuel cut) oh, and the CEL blinks off then on again when it bucks. my car is a 1996 Eclipse GS w/ a 98 engine. Greddy header, straight pipe and HKS exhaust all heat wraped. Injen Race CAI. EGR block off kit. idles very smooth at 16mmhg w/ no creep or bounce on the gauge. oil pressure is steady across the range too. i have changed some things to help this problem to no avail. runnign NGK plugs -11e iirc? (2 ranges hotter)gaped to .65 as per instructions, Magnecor 8mm wires and a Screamin Deamon coil. changed back to stock coil and regaped plugs to .50 and still bucked. kept gap and changed to deamon coil. nope still bucks
Pulling the codes dosent reveal anything other than EGR flow(duh)

94348, RE: HELP!! Car bucking like a Mule!! Poss Ign., fuel prob? kinda long Posted by mcgyvr, Nov-08-05 03:16 AM
#1 get stock range plugs, 2 heat ranges will cause serious problems, esp when boosted. I bet you already have a crack in the insulator of the plug
stock gap is .045 or so. go to that
coil pack doesnt matter
so.. get stock heat range plugs,gap to .045 and try that
your obviously misfiring..
